The idea of the sleeve is that it extends inside beyond the end of the original drain hole so that if the original drain did become disconnected then the insert will hold everything in place, at least hopefully long enough until you detect it on your next regular inspection, and minimise any water ingress. _______________________________________________

You can also pull the headlining away, just in front of the rear grab handle and shine a torch up to see where the rubber tube attaches.
